tigerkoi said:
Hi John,

Nice car. Is it always that low, or has it been purposefully lowered?
Might be a trick of the eye, but curiosity is getting the better of me smile
It is fitted with a Renntech lowering module and is only that low when parked up. Usually raise it a bit using ABC when moving. Just thought it looked odd when I fitted the 19" wheels so decided to fit the lowing module which is expensive but gives you ultimate control over ride height.
